... Read moreFrom personal experience, navigating dating while being a parent can be quite complex. One major aspect is setting clear boundaries not only with your partner but also in how your children perceive new relationships. It’s crucial to create a safe and respectful environment where both your child and your partner feel comfortable. Watching Love Island casting discussions highlight these themes reminds me of my own journey. For example, I’ve learned that openly communicating about parenting roles and expectations early in dating can prevent misunderstandings later. It’s not just about attraction but how someone fits into your family’s dynamic. Another important topic that emerged is how a parent’s dating life can impact the child emotionally. Children may need time to adjust and feel safe, so respecting their pace is key. As one quote implies, questions arise around the line between personal intimacy and the child’s comfort—highlighting the importance of discretion and empathy in blended family situations. Ultimately, the intersection of love, parenting, and respect requires patience and honest dialogue. Whether on reality TV or in real life, these conversations are essential to fostering healthy relationships where all parties feel valued and secure.
